Five Held For Beating Army Jawan To Death In Ganjam

Berhampur: Five persons were arrested for allegedly beating Army jawan, Dilleswar Patra to death in Haripur village of Ganjam district on Friday. Previous enmity between two groups in the village was said to be the reason for the incident.

The arrested persons have been identified as J Kalyani Patra (19), Ch Shekhar Patra (23), B Cheneya Patra (26), B Bulu Patra (26) and Ch Vicky Patra (26). The police have also seized two bikes and two mobile phones from the accused.

According to reports, Dilleswar, a resident of Kalipalli village was posted at Pannagada in West Bengal’s Durgapur district. He had come home on leave around a week ago.

On December 3, he was assaulted by some miscreants while returning home after watching a cricket match at Haripur Street in Chamakhandi. Being seriously injured in the incident, he was first admitted to MKCG Medical College and Hospital and then shifted to a private hospital in Bhubaneswar, where doctors declared him dead.
